This is my first cabinet project, so far so good. I bought the lowers from home depot, they are pretty cheap but have Red Oak facia, the rest I built with 3/4" red oak ply wood and 1x2 and 1x3 trim. I am going to attemt to build some speakers for the top shelves with some help from an audiophile buddy, and screen them in. The TV opening is just right for Samsungs 50" DLP, which I will have to save up for, all the audio video stuff will be in the double cabinets below.
